Fake house owner took Dh31,000 from tenant

A fake property owner who used forged documents to swindle Dh31,000 out of a tenant was sentenced to a year and a half in jail followed by deportation.

MAH, 28, Syrian, forged a residency stamp on a passport that carried another person’s name and forged a flat property ownership certificate with which he conned a tenant.

The victim HS, 34, Lebanese manager, testified that while his wife was looking for a flat to let on dubizzle.com, she found an ad of a flat in Discovery Gardens for Dh25,000.

“I called the given mobile number and met the landlord who claimed his name was “Mohammed Al Shahiri” and gave him my wife’s passport photocopy, signed the contract and paid him Dh28,000 as the rent and Dh3,000 as deposit. I got a receipt for the payment. He also handed me an ownership certificate and a passport photocopy.

“Three days later, an Egyptian knocked at the door and asked me if I wish to renew my contract. I told him that I have just renewed the rent contract for the flat and showed him the documents. I called MAH and he confessed that he had falsely claimed ownership of the flat as he needed money and sought forgiveness,” he testified.

MAH confessed before the police that he found a passport photocopy of a Syrian on the Internet. He falsified his passport photocopy by placing his picture and the residency visa stamp and made it in the same name as of the original holder.

Dubai Lands Department reported that the ownership certificate’s copy was forged. The DNRD also reported that the visa stamp was forged.
